Sounds like a movement

This past weekend the Saskatchewan Parks and Recreation Association (SPRA) hosted their annual conference. In partnership with Saskatchewan in motion brought Farley Flex to Saskatchewan to speak as one of the key notes. He posed some very good questions. Do you ever stop and really ask yourself what makes you make choose to live the way you do? Or are you simply swept up in whirl wind of life set out before you? In a few more eloquent words he said that your life is not your own and you leave no legacy if you don’t know why you make the choices you do. Sometimes we can convince ourselves we are covering all the bases. We say, “heck ya, I’ve got this cased”. He’s very good at making you want to run out of the building and make something happen! I’ve found the same thing from other people in the past, but when you try to go and do something you find yourself going – - great, but how? Farley was awesome cuz he tells you! He makes things uncomplicated that otherwise seem so twisted. With all this beauty and simplicity he is also realistic.
